Archbishop Okeke gives scholarship to best Anambra JSS 3 student, other
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Whatsapp

The Metropolitan Catholic Archbishop of Onitsha Diocese, Most Rev. Valerian Okeke has given scholarships for two academic sessions/years each to two outstanding students of All Hallows Seminary Onitsha, Anambra State, ANAMBRA PEOPLE reports.

The prelate made the pronouncement during the occasion of the Patronal Feast (All Saints) and Parents’/Benefactors’/Alumni’s Day of All Hallows Seminary, Onitsha.

The beneficiary, Master Iji John Paul came out with overall best result out of over 5000 students from all the secondary schools who sat for the last 2022 Junior Secondary School Certificate Examination (JSSCE) in Anambra State.

Another student beneficiary was Master John Otiwu, who sang with a soprano/tenor voice during the students choir rendition at the All Saints feast celebration.

According to Archbishop Okeke, we are proud of students of All Hallows Seminary, Onitsha, which is the oldest seminary school in the whole of Southeast and one of the best known for academic excellence and high moral standards.
